a child with a disability


A student who has been properly evaluated in accordance with regulations who is found to have a disability which results in the need for special education and related services.

accommodations in state-wide assessment


Changes in format, response, setting, timing or scheduling that do not alter in any significant way what the test measures or the comparability of scores.

age of majority


Rights are transferred from the parent to the student on the student's 18th birthday. This must be addressed by the IEP team prior to the student reaching age 18.

adapted physical education


This related service is for students with disabilities who require developmental or corrective instruction.

administrative unit


District, county office, or agency identified in the Local Plan having, among other duties, the responsibility to receive and distribute funds in support of the Local Plan.

alternate curriculum


The alternate curriculum is used for students with moderate to severe disabilities to access the seven core areas of the California State Frameworks

assistive technology device


Any item, piece of equipment, or product system that is used to increase, maintain, or improve the functional capabilities of a child with a disability.
